age groups. Lymph node aspirates were analysed with polymerase
chain reaction (PCR). Two numbers of dogs were
found to be positive by PCR. The PCR positive dogs showed
modified direct agglutination test (MDAT) titre of 1:512 and
1:4,096. The remaining sera samples showed the titre value of
less than 1:64 byMDAT andwere also negative by PCR. This
study indicates that lymph node aspirates could be an alternative
ideal specimen for the detection of T. gondii.
